Prep work is see this page crucial to the last outcomes. All timber requires to be cleaned up well before discoloration, whether it's a brand-new deck, or an older deck that's been out in the weather condition and requires to be re-stained.

On an older deck, dirt, graying from the sunlight, mold as well as old stains all require to be eliminated prior to discoloration. You ought to use a deck scrub for the cleansing procedure.

If there is a develop Related Site of old discolorations on the deck then the task gets a little tougher however not difficult. You can make use of a discolor stripper which will eliminate most weathered discolorations in a solitary application. If there are small places of tarnish that won't come off throughout the cleansing procedure, they need to sand off quickly.

If places of stain are left on the deck, they will show through the brand-new coating and also detract from the deck's last look. Allow the deck to dry for one week after cleansing prior to applying stain.

Read the label initially as well as you're most likely to get it right the first time. There are a whole lot of different ways to apply the deck discolor. Repaint brush as well as paint roller are both most popular. No matter exactly how you use your timber discolor, maintain a paint brush at hand.

If you are splashing or rolling the tarnish, always back-brush it in with a brush while the stain is still wet as well as you'll achieve a lot far better infiltration in to the timber.
